The Tower of Spanu (Corsican: Torra di Spanu) is a ruined Genoese tower located in the commune of Lumio on the west coast of the Corsica. It sits on the Punta Spano headland at a height of 25 metres (82 ft) above the sea. Only the lower portion of the tower survives.The tower was one of a series of coastal defences constructed by the Republic of Genoa between 1530 and 1620 to stem the attacks by Barbary pirates.
